D’Andre Swift goes ‘Fly, Eagles Fly’ over Antoine Winfield Jr. on 26-yard run

D’Andre Swift took to the air like an Eagle on a 26-yard gain

Philadelphia Eagles running back D’Andre Swift took off through a huge hole in the third quarter at Raymond James Stadium on Monday against the Tampa Bay Buccaneers.

When Swift finally encountered a Bucs defender, it was Antoine Winfield Jr., a star in the Tampa Bay secondary.

Swift decided to become a hurdler and literally took off. You know, “Fly, Eagles Fly.”

The drive culminated in a sneak for the TD by Jalen Hurts as the Eagles were out to a 22-3 lead after the PAT.
